Boy was I wrong when I stepped into Kazu at Cuppage. I was warned to make a reservation, but I did not have the number and thought I went pretty early to avoid the crowd. The waitress informed me that I had an hour as I was sitting at a table reserved for someone else. With that in mind and the fact that yakitori had to be done only when the order is made, I decided to just go with the set and whale sashimi.
Some lettuce with some lemon and a sesame based sauce cleared my stomach for the meal. The sashimi was very fresh, melts in your mouth and burned a hole in my pocket. $6 bucks a peice. The yakitori rocks. Cooked to perfection. I would love to order from the menu if I had more time to slowly choose.
